Ruby Irene Carter's Obituary
Ruby Irene Carter, 93, of Clinton, Iowa, passed away Thursday, January 30, 2025 at the home of her daughter in Clinton, Iowa.
Funeral services will be held at 11:00AM Monday, February 3, 2025 at Calvary Baptist Church Clinton. Visitation will be held Monday from 9:00AM until the service hour. Burial will take place at 10:00AM Tuesday, February 4, 2025 at Clinton Lawn Cemetery. Online condolences may be expressed by visiting snellzornig.com. Snell-Zornig assisted the family with arrangements.
Ruby was born July 21, 1931 in Hermann, MO, the daughter of Armin A. and Louise Barbara (Heinlein) Koeller. Ruby married Joseph Walker June 23, 1968 in Otterville, Illinois; he died July 18, 1997. She later married Paul Carter March 31, 2001 in Clinton, Iowa; he died June 8, 2021.
Ruby had been employed at General Electric in Morrison, Illinois for 25 years and was a homemaker. She was a member of Calvary Baptist Church.
Survivors include her children: Donna Burkley of Clinton; Dennis (Amber) Schmidt of Hermann, MO; Lana Zimmerman of Clinton; Robert (Ruth) Zimmerman of Delmar, IA; Denise (Mark) Wood of Clinton, IA; Cheryl (Mike) Clark of Norwood, MO; Jeri (Jason) Shaw of Hallsville, MO and David (Lori) Zimmerman of Fulton, IL; 27 grandchildren; 51 great-grandchildren; 16 great great-grandchildren and brothers, Benjamin (Carol) Priess of St. Charles, MO and Clarence (Carol) Priess of Hermann, MO.
In addition to her husbands, she was preceded in death by her parents; son, William Schmidt; great-grandson, Julian Zimmerman; sisters, Dorothy and Laverne and brothers, Armin, Forrest and Edward.
Memorials may be made to the Children’s Organ Transplant Association (COTA), or to Calvary Baptist Church, Clinton.
